Newton's Second Law of Motion
Sir Isaac Newton first presented his three laws of motion in the "Principia Mathematica Philosophiae Naturalis" in 1686. His second law defines a force to be equal to the differential change in momentum per unit time as described by the calculus of mathematics, which Newton also developed. The momentum is defined to be the mass of an object m times its velocity v . So the differential equation for force F is: ...

The important fact is that a force will cause a change in velocity; and likewise, a change in velocity will generate a force. The equation works both ways. The velocity, force, acceleration, and momentum have both a magnitude and a direction associated with them. Scientists and mathematicians call this a vector quantity . EIA kid's page - Newton's Second Law of Motion
F = ma : Newton's second law of motion states that the net force acting on an object equals the product of the mass ( m ) times the acceleration ( a ) of the object. The direction of the force is the same as that of the acceleration. ...

Ask A Scientist -Weekly Posting
Dear John,Atoms are governed by quantum mechanics, so you have to expect them tobehave strangely by Newtonian standards.Consider the hydrogen atom. This is the simplest atom, consisting of aproton and an electron. When the electron is captured by the proton, itwill "see" a large (infinite) number of energy levels. If it gives upenough energy to be captured in a high energy level, it can then lose moreenergy by emitting photons as it descends to lower energy level. Finally itarrives at the lowest energy level. This is one place where quantummechanics differs from classical mechanics -- the moon can continuouslyreduce the radius of its orbit about the earth until it finally crashes intothe earth.When the electron reaches its lowest energy state, it is far from the edgeof the proton -- the radius of its orbit is about 1000 times larger than theradius of the proton.
